    Resumen: Siguiendo el modelo del nivel único de participación de la sociedad civil en su negociación, la Convención sobre los Derechos de las Personas con Discapacidad (CDPD) estipula claramente las obligaciones de Los Estados Partes consultarán e involucrarán a las personas con discapacidad a través de su representante (OPD), en la implementación y seguimiento de la CDPD (artículo 4(3) y 33(3)). Este énfasis en la participación de las personas con discapacidad ha sido una respuesta a su exclusión sistemática de los mecanismos de consulta y toma de decisiones relacionados con diseño, planificación y seguimiento de políticas, programas y servicios que inciden en sus vidas y sus comunidades

    In this paper we describe a system that can be used to generate action effect specifications. Unlike those like STRIPS commonly used in AI planning, our system uses an action description language that allows one to specify the effects of actions using domain rules, which are state constraints that can entail new action effects from old ones. Declaratively, an action domain in our language corresponds to a nonmonotonic causal theory in the situation calculus. Procedurally, such an action domain is compiled into a set of propositional theories, one for each action in the domain, from which fully instantiated successor state-like axioms and STRIPS-like systems are then generated. Theoretically, we show that the procedural semantics is sound with respect to the declarative semantics.     This concise paper describes the introduction of a technology unit into the BAppIS degree programme at UCOL trading as Manawatu Polytechnic. The reasons for its introduction are provided. The unit is described in terms of its content, assessment method and performance criteria. The unit is evaluated from the perspective of unit content, student outcomes, performance criteria and student feedback evaluations. The concise paper fully details an implementation plan for the introduction of the unit into other degree programmes complete with the technology and software requirements. The robot is recipient of information via a simplex communications channel from a PC. The robot also has different sensors. The simplex channel is used to download robot programmes to control the robot's actuation elements and use the sensors as a feedback mechanism for these elements. The robot is a self-contained unit it does not need the PC once the correct program has been downloaded. Many theoretical elements of hardware integration can be experienced by the students: multiple feedback control, transduction, actuation, error-self-correcting sequences, simplex communications, robot construction and protection. The students construct a thermocouple device from scratch, as well as analogue to digital, digital to analogue, operations amplification and power amplification. This operation shows the students the difficulty of constructing instrumentation from scratch.     This paper looks into the results of the exploration of corpus data from PRESEEA for "y" and perceived lenghtened "y" in order to determine if there is a relation between perceived durational lengthening and topic shift in Spanish conversations
